What is SCHD?
SCHD is an exchange-traded fund offered by Charles Schwab that primarily invests in high dividend yielding U.S. equities. The fund is created to track the efficiency of the Dow Jones U.S. Dividend 100 Index, which chooses business based upon several metrics, including dividend yield, financial health, and a performance history of paying dividends. This makes SCHD a popular option for income-oriented investors.

Dividend Payment Frequency
schd dividend Time frame - codimd.fiksel.info, pays dividends quarterly, which prevails for lots of ETFs and shared funds. Here's a summary of the dividend payment schedule:
QuarterDividend Declaration DateEx-Dividend DateDividend Payment DateQ1 2023February 24, 2023March 2, 2023March 10, 2023Q2 2023May 25, 2023June 1, 2023June 9, 2023Q3 2023August 25, 2023September 1, 2023September 8, 2023Q4 2023November 24, 2023December 1, 2023December 8, 2023Crucial Dates Explained
Declaration Date: This is the date on which the fund reveals the dividend quantity and payment schedule.

Ex-Dividend Date: Shareholders should own the shares before this date to get the approaching dividend. If bought on or after this date, the investor will not receive the stated dividend.

Payment Date: This is the date when the fund disperses the dividends to qualified shareholders.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)1. How can I begin buying SCHD?
Investors can acquire SCHD through any brokerage account that uses access to ETFs. It's necessary to perform due diligence and think about how to calculate schd dividend it fits into your total financial investment strategy.
2. Are dividends from SCHD taxable?
Yes, dividends received from SCHD are typically subject to federal income tax. Depending upon your tax scenario, they might also be subject to state taxes.
3. What are the dangers of purchasing dividend ETFs like SCHD?
Like any financial investment, there are dangers involved. These consist of market risk, rates of interest risk, and the danger of individual business lowering or suspending dividends. Investors ought to carefully consider their danger tolerance.
4. How do SCHD dividends compare to other dividend ETFs?
Compared to other dividend ETFs, SCHD typically provides attractive yields paired with a lower cost ratio, and a concentrate on quality companies. However, it's always wise to compare efficiency metrics and underlying holdings.
5. Can I automatically reinvest my SCHD dividends?
Yes, lots of brokerage companies provide a Dividend Reinvestment Plan (DRIP), enabling investors to automatically reinvest dividends into additional shares of SCHD, which can improve compound growth in time.
